Bug Description
Hello, can we change the default sort order of bugs on Ubuntu packages?
I'd like to propose that we sort by bug number as a default.
Priority isn't very useful -- mostly this brings bugs from a decade ago to the top of the list. Priorities are basically unused in Ubuntu, so I expect many frequent users need to request the bug list twice: once to load the page, a second time to click the "bug number" button on the page.
This has proven to be confusing for new team members and us old team members have been requesting the different sort order for a while just as rote.
